Casemaster Plazma Pro 6 Dart Case with Front Pocket vs Casemaster Plazma Pro 6-dart case
Key Differences
Both are Casemaster Plazma Pro 6-dart cases with nearly identical ratings and review counts; Product A highlights built-in storage tubes and a front mobile device pocket while Product B emphasizes holding six fully assembled darts and a large front pocket for phone/glasses. Choose A if you want explicit built-in storage tubes and extra internal pockets; choose B if you prioritize confirmed fit for fully assembled darts and a large external pocket
Casemaster Plazma Pro 6 Dart Case with Front Pocket
Casemaster Plazma Pro holds up to six darts in hard foam slots with extra pockets for accessories and a front pocket for a phone. Durable construction with textured surface for grip. Customers praise storage capacity and build quality, though some note zipper and foam padding concerns
Pros
- holds up to six darts in foam slots
- extra pockets for accessories
- front pocket for phone
- textured surface improves grip
Cons
- some durability and zipper quality issues
- foam density criticized for lack of padding
Casemaster Plazma Pro 6-dart case
Casemaster Plazma Pro case protects 6 fully assembled darts with foam inserts and multiple pockets for accessories. Noted for spacious design and storage capacity, with mixed durability and zipper feedback
Pros
- rigid shell with foam inserts
- large front pocket for smartphone or glasses
- multiple pockets for flights, shafts, tips, and accessories
- two tubes for spare tips or shafts
Cons
- mixed durability feedback
- zipper quality issues reported
